Delivering Divorce Documents: Employing a Process Server

When navigating the often challenging process of divorce, one crucial step involves formally delivering divorce papers to your spouse. This legal formality demands precise adherence to specific procedures, and that's where a professional process server comes in. Hiring a process server ensures that the documents are legitimately delivered, providing you with evidence of service.

A process server is a skilled individual authorized to handle official legal presentations. They understand the nuances of serving divorce papers and can successfully navigate any potential obstacles to ensure proper completion of this important step.

  • Advantages of hiring a process server include their expertise with legal procedures, ability to locate and serve your spouse even if they are evasive to find, and their commitment to providing accurate records of service.
  • Consider factors such as the process server's background, standing within the legal community, and their charges before making a decision.

By selecting a reputable process server, you can ensure that divorce papers are served correctly and comply with all here legal requirements, simplifying the overall divorce process.

Serving Divorce Papers Cost Breakdown

Getting a divorce is already a difficult process. On top of that, you've got to think about the costs involved. One cost that often gets overlooked is hiring a process server to officially deliver your divorce papers to your other half.

The amount you pay will rely on several factors, including the jurisdiction where you live, how complex your case is, and if there are any extra steps involved. In general, expect to shell out anywhere from a hundred dollars for a simple service to several hundred euros for more complicated cases.

It's always best to get quotes from multiple process servers before making a decision. This will help you evaluate their rates and services so you can opt for the best option for your needs.
